My Buying Guides on Best Canned Fried Apples

When I look for the best canned fried apples, I focus on flavor, texture, ingredients, and how well they fit into different recipes. Over time, I’ve learned that not all canned fried apples taste the same, and the best ones can make a big difference whether I’m serving breakfast, dessert, or a quick side dish.

1. Taste and Sweetness

The first thing I pay attention to is the flavor. I prefer canned fried apples that taste naturally sweet and have a good balance of cinnamon and spice. Some brands are overly sugary, while others taste more like real cooked apples. For me, the best option is the one that feels homemade and not artificial.

2. Texture of the Apples

Texture matters a lot to me. I like apples that are tender but still hold their shape. If they turn mushy, I usually lose interest. The best canned fried apples should feel soft enough to eat easily, but not so overcooked that they become a puree.

3. Ingredient Quality

I always check the ingredient list before buying. I prefer products made with real apples, natural spices, and fewer artificial additives. If I can find canned fried apples with simple ingredients and no unnecessary preservatives, that usually gives me more confidence in the product.

4. Syrup or Sauce Consistency

The sauce is just as important as the apples themselves. I like a thick, flavorful syrup that coats the apples well without being too runny. If the sauce is too thin, it feels less satisfying; if it’s too heavy, it can overpower the apples. The ideal consistency for me is smooth and rich.

5. Versatility in Recipes

I also think about how I’ll use the canned fried apples. Some brands work better as a side dish, while others are great for pies, cobblers, pancakes, or topping pork dishes. I usually choose a product that I can use in multiple ways so I get more value from it.

6. Portion Size and Packaging

Packaging is another detail I consider. If I’m cooking for my family, I like larger cans or multi-pack options. For smaller meals or occasional use, a single can is enough. I also look for packaging that is easy to open and store, especially if I don’t use the whole can at once.

7. Brand Reputation and Reviews

I often rely on brand reputation and customer reviews before making a purchase. If other buyers consistently mention good flavor and texture, I feel more comfortable trying it myself. A trusted brand usually gives me a better chance of getting a product I’ll enjoy.

8. Price and Value

Price is always part of my decision, but I don’t choose based on cost alone. I look for the best value, meaning good taste, quality ingredients, and useful portion size at a fair price. Sometimes paying a little more is worth it if the flavor and quality are noticeably better.
